The ingredients needed to make Homemade hamburger helper:
  1. Take 1 lb ground burger
  2. Make ready 1/2 white onion
  3. Take 1/2 yellow bell pepper
  4. Take 1 can cream of mushroom soup
  5. Get 2 1/2 tbsp flour
  6. Take 1 1/2 cup noodles
  7. Take 1/2 cup frozen green beans
  8. Take 2 tsp salt
  9. Take 1 tsp garlic powder
  10. Make ready 1/2 tsp cajun seasoning
  11. Take 2 cup water
  12. Make ready 1/2 tsp italian seasoning

Instructions to make Homemade hamburger helper:
  1. In a deep pan, add ground meat, onion, and pepper, salt, garlic, Italian seasoning. Cook till meat is fully cooked and onions r translucent.
  2. Very important: do NOT drain.
  3. Add flour, and stir until all incorporated. Add cream of mushroom and all the water. Bring to light boil.
  4. Add noodles and green beans. Bring back to boil stirring every couple minutes.
  5. Turn on low for about 20 minutes or until noodles are soft…
